Bridging the Digital Divide: Access and Equity in Telecommunications
The digital divide, a stark chasm between those who have access to information and communication technologies (ICTs) and those who don't, remains a pressing concern in today's interconnected world. This inequality has profound effects on education, employment, healthcare, and overall societal progress. Bridging this divide demands a multifaceted approach that solves the underlying causes contributing to unequal access to telecommunications.
- One crucial aspect is expanding infrastructure in underserved areas, particularly in rural locations.
- Subsidized internet plans and devices are essential to ensure that individuals and families can afford ICTs without facing financial hardship.
- Computer proficiency programs can empower individuals to harness technology for their benefit.

Ensuring Network Integrity: Data Protection in a Hyperconnected World
In an increasingly interconnected world, telecommunications networks serve as the vital infrastructure upon which modern society relies. Unfortunately, this connectivity comes with inherent vulnerabilities. Cyberattacks are becoming increasingly sophisticated, targeting these networks to steal sensitive data, disrupt services, and cause widespread damage. Consequently, robust data security measures are essential to mitigate these threats and protect the integrity of our digital world.
- Integrating strong authentication protocols is crucial to validate user identities and prevent unauthorized access to networks.
- Encryption techniques are essential to safeguard sensitive information as it travels across networks, ensuring confidentiality and integrity.
- Regular security audits can help identify weaknesses and vulnerabilities that threat agents could exploit.
Moreover, encouraging a culture of security awareness among users is critical. Training individuals about best practices for online safety, such as recognizing phishing attempts and using strong passwords, can significantly minimize the risk of successful attacks.
